Subject: Pixelshear CLI 0.9 in the release channel

Welcome, new folks. Pixelshear is our internal CLI for batch image resizing; 0.9 just landed in the release channel. It adds parallel workers, WebP output, and a dry-run flag. If you're onboarding, run it against the sample-assets bucket first — it's safe and fast. Known limitation: EXIF rotation isn't applied yet, so portrait images may come out sideways. Report anything odd in the tooling tracker. This build is identified by the token below.

pipeline stamp: htk3_69f

Re: idempotency keys in the Tollgate retry path — the key derivation looks sound, but we should bound how long keys stay replayable and how many retries share one key, otherwise a captured key is a standing replay window. I pulled the relevant knobs into one block for review; current values below.

limits module of tafop-hahop:
WEIGHTS = {
    "julmir": 223,
    "belox": 987,
    "lamion": 470,
    "pelath": 609,
    "fraok": 1010,
    "eliion": 343,
    "drudor": 342,
}

TURN-208: Gatevale turnstile counters at the Merrow Field pilot double-count when a rotation reverses mid-cycle. Attendance totals drift roughly 2% high per event. The debounce window fix is implemented, reviewed by Ilsa, and soak-tested across two simulated match days without drift. Ready for your cut; the candidate build is identified below.

trace token, tagag-tafog: htk6_5ed18c

Subject: Catalog cache cut-over done

Switched Grovelist's product catalog from TTL-only eviction to event-driven invalidation last night. Publish events now purge entries directly; the old sweeper job is disabled. Watch for stale-read reports during review — none so far. Diff touches only the cache layer and the event consumer. The active invalidation configuration now reads as follows.

deployment values, yadup-kadug:
[sorys]
port = 5672
team = noveth
host = sorys.orvexcorp.example
region = south-4
access_code = ac_deddc1
timeout_ms = 1500